Cloud9 IDE

AWS Cloud9 is a cloud-based integrated development environment (IDE) that lets you write, run, and debug your code with just a browser. It includes a code editor, debugger, and terminal. Cloud9 comes pre-packaged with essential tools for popular programming languages and the AWS Command Line Interface (CLI) pre-installed so you don’t need to install files or configure your computer for this workshop. Your Cloud9 environment will have access to the same AWS resources as the user with which you logged into the AWS Management Console.

Instructions

  1. Go to the AWS Management Console, select services then select Cloud9 under Developer Tools
  2. Select create environment
  3. Enter Development into name and optionally provide a description
  4. Select next step
  5. You may accept the environment settings defaults
  6. Select next step
  7. Review the environment settings and select create environment. It will take several minutes for your environment to be provisioned and prepared
  8. Once ready, your IDE will open to a welcome screen. Below that, you should see a terminal window

You can run AWS CLI commands in the terminal window like you would on your local computer. Verify that your user is logged in by running:

aws sts get-caller-identity

You’ll see output indicating your account and user information:

{
    "Account": "123456789012",
    "UserId": "AKIAI44QH8DHBEXAMPLE",
    "Arn": "arn:aws:iam::123456789012:user/Alice"
}

Keep your AWS Cloud9 environment open in a tab throughout this workshop.